Carrboro Alderwoman Joal Hall Broun will not seek re-election. She released this statement this morning:
"Thank you to all of my supporters, the voters and the people of Carrboro. I enjoyed serving the citizens of Carrboro for the past twelve years. I will continue to be engaged and involved in my community in Carrboro and Orange County. However, I will not be seeking re-election to the Board of Aldermen at this time."
Three seats on the board, plus the mayor, are up this fall. Mayor Mark Chilton, Alderman Dan Coleman and Alderwoman Lydia Lavelle filed Friday, along with newcomer Michelle Johnson. The filing period ends July 15.
